Helen A. Sauerhage, nee Seering, 89, of Lively Grove, IL, born April 26, 1936, in St. Clair County, IL died Tuesday, May 27, 2025, at Washington County Hospital.
Helen was a retired supervisor for the United States Department of Agriculture and a member of St. Anthony Catholic Church in Lively Grove, IL.
She is preceded in death by her parents, Erwin and Frances, nee Grobe, Seering, her husband, Lawrence E. Sauerhage who died Aug. 2, 2013, a daughter, Rebecca in infancy, sisters-in-law, and brothers-in-law.
Helen is survived by her daughter, Deb (Jeff) Lehde; grandson, Benjamin (Sara) Sauerhage; great grandchildren, Brennan Compton (Sydney Anderson), Barin Compton, Brynnley Compton, Benning Sauerhage; great great grandchildren, Gracelynn and Laken; sisters-in-law, Betty and Helen Sauerhage; brother-in-law, Earl Steffen; and numerous nieces, nephews, cousins and friends.
